Gather Your Tools and Materials

Before diving into the battery replacement, ensure you have the following items readily available:

  • A new CR2032 battery: This is the standard battery type used in most Ford Flex key fobs. You can find them at most electronics stores, supermarkets, and online retailers.
  • A small flathead screwdriver: This will be used to pry open the key fob casing.
  • A pair of tweezers (optional): Tweezers can be helpful for removing the old battery if it’s stuck.

Locate the Battery Compartment

The battery compartment on your Ford Flex key fob is typically located on the back side. Look for a small seam or a small release button.

Open the Key Fob

  • If your key fob has a release button: Press the button to open the casing.
  • If your key fob has a seam: Use your flathead screwdriver to gently pry open the casing along the seam. Be careful not to apply too much force, as you could damage the key fob.

Remove the Old Battery

Once the casing is open, you’ll see the old battery nestled inside. Gently remove the battery using your fingers or tweezers. Pay attention to the positive (+) and negative (-) terminals on the battery. This will help you correctly install the new battery.

Insert the New Battery

Take your new CR2032 battery and align it with the positive (+) and negative (-) terminals inside the key fob. Carefully slide the new battery into place. Ensure it sits snugly and makes good contact with the terminals.

Close the Key Fob

Once the new battery is in place, gently close the key fob casing. Make sure it snaps shut securely.

Test the Key Fob

Now it’s time to test your newly equipped key fob. Try locking and unlocking your Ford Flex. If the key fob is working properly, you should hear the locks engaging and disengaging. You can also test the panic button to ensure it’s functioning correctly.

Q: How long does a Ford Flex key fob battery typically last?

A: The lifespan of a key fob battery can vary depending on usage and environmental factors. However, a CR2032 battery typically lasts between 1-3 years.

Q: What should I do if my key fob battery is completely dead and I can’t get into my car?

A: If your key fob battery is completely dead, you can use the mechanical key that comes with your key fob to unlock your car. You can then use the ignition key to start the vehicle.

Q: Can I use a different type of battery in my Ford Flex key fob?

A: It’s not recommended to use a different type of battery. The CR2032 battery is specifically designed for key fobs and provides the right voltage and size for optimal performance.

Q: How often should I replace my Ford Flex key fob battery?

A: It’s a good idea to replace your key fob battery every 1-2 years, even if it’s still working. This will help to prevent your key fob from dying unexpectedly.

Q: Can I buy a new key fob if I lose the original?

A: Yes, you can buy a new key fob from your local Ford dealership or an authorized locksmith. You will need to provide proof of ownership for your vehicle, and the new key fob will need to be programmed to work with your car.
